Abstract

The invention relates to a disinfection device, in particular to a disinfection device for nursing in a urological department. The technical problem is as follows: provides a urological department nursing disinfection device which is automatic in disinfection and convenient in operation. The technical scheme is as follows: a urological department nursing disinfection device, comprising: a support; the upper side in the bracket is provided with a disinfection component; the disinfecting component is provided with two nozzles; the electric push rod is arranged on one side inside the bracket; place the subassembly, the support is inside to be equipped with places the subassembly. The invention has the beneficial effects that: people place medical supplies in first material frame of putting, start electric putter, when gear and first rack contact, can drive gear and first material frame anticlockwise rotation ninety degrees of putting, start the water pump this moment, the water pump can be with the antiseptic solution through main oral siphon, reposition of redundant personnel oral siphon and shower nozzle spray to first medical supplies of putting in the material frame on to disinfect work.

Detailed Description
The following description is only a preferred embodiment of the present invention, and does not limit the scope of the present invention.
Example 1
A disinfection device for nursing in urological department is shown in figures 1-5 and comprises a support 1, spray heads 2, a disinfection component 3, an electric push rod 4 and a placement component 5, wherein the disinfection component 3 is arranged on the upper side inside the support 1, the two spray heads 2 are arranged on the disinfection component 3, the electric push rod 4 is arranged on the rear side inside the support 1, and the placement component 5 is arranged inside the support 1.
The disinfection component 3 comprises a water pump 301, a main water inlet pipe 302, a shunt water inlet pipe 303 and a first support frame 304, the water pump 301 is arranged on the upper side of the rear inside the support 1, the main water inlet pipe 302 is arranged on the left side and the right side of the water pump 301, the main water inlet pipe 302 is connected with the support 1, the shunt water inlet pipe 303 is symmetrically arranged on the front side of the main water inlet pipe 302, the shunt water inlet pipe 303 on the same side is connected with the first support frame 304, and the first support frame 304 is respectively connected with the spray head 2.
The placing assembly 5 comprises a first guide rod 501, a first movable frame 502, a first material placing frame 503, a gear 504, a first rack 505 and a second rack 506, the first guide rod 501 is arranged on the rear side inside the support 1, the first movable frame 502 is arranged on the upper side of the first guide rod 501 in a sliding mode, the first movable frame 502 is connected with a telescopic rod of the electric push rod 4, the first material placing frame 503 is arranged on the front side of the first movable frame 502 in a rotating mode, the gears 504 are arranged on the left side and the right side of the first material placing frame 503, the first racks 505 are symmetrically arranged on the rear side inside the support 1 in a left-right mode, the first racks 505 are respectively matched with the gears 504, the second racks 506 are symmetrically arranged on the front side inside the support 1 in a left-right mode, and the second racks 506 are respectively matched with the gears 504.
People place medical supplies in the first material placing frame 503, disinfectant is injected into the water pump 301, then people start the electric push rod 4, the telescopic rod of the electric push rod 4 can drive the first movable frame 502 to move up and down, when the first movable frame 502 moves downwards, the first material placing frame 503 and the gear 504 can be driven to move downwards, when the gear 504 is in contact with the first rack 505, the gear 504 and the first material placing frame 503 can be driven to rotate ninety degrees anticlockwise, at the moment, the water pump 301 is started, the water pump 301 can spray the disinfectant onto the medical supplies in the first material placing frame 503 through the main water inlet pipe 302, the shunt water inlet pipe 303 and the spray head 2, so as to carry out disinfection work, when the gear 504 continues to move downwards to be in contact with the second rack 506, the first material placing frame 503 can be driven to rotate one hundred eighty degrees clockwise, at the moment, the medical supplies in the first material placing frame 503 can fall downwards, and people can collect the disinfectant, then the telescopic rod of the electric push rod 4 can drive the first movable frame 502 to move upwards to reset, and after the work is completed, people can close the water pump 301 and the electric push rod 4.
